King Pu-tsung (Chinese: 金溥聰; pinyin: Jīn Pǔcōng; born 30 August 1956) is a Taiwanese journalist and politician. He was the secretary-general of the National Security Council from 2014 to 2015. Previously, he was the head of the Taipei Economic and Cultural Representative Office in the United States from 2012 to 2014 and the deputy mayor of Taipei from 2004 to 2006.
